Typical Total Price for a Residential Torsion Spring Replacement

Most homeowners spend between $350 and $800 for a complete torsion spring replacement on a standard two-car garage door, including parts and labor. The low end reflects basic spring kits with minimal labor, while the high end covers premium springs, additional safety devices, and regionally higher labor rates. Assumptions: standard 7- or 8-foot door, standard winding, no frame damage, Midwest or similar market.

Material and Spring Type Differences That Move the Price

Coated or galvanized springs cost more but last longer, while heavy-duty or double-spring setups increase both parts and labor time. A typical single torsion spring may cost less than a dual-spring or high-torque option. Coatings like zinc or polymer reduce corrosion in coastal regions, pushing price upward slightly but potentially lowering long-term maintenance. Assumptions: standard residential door with 7–8 ft height, standard torque range.

Regional Variations: How City and State Change Torsion Spring Costs

Prices rise in urban areas and coastal regions due to higher labor rates and material costs. Expect 5–20% higher average quotes in large metro regions compared with rural markets. In the Midwest or Southeast, estimates often skew toward the lower end of ranges due to competition and lower living costs. Assumptions: same door size, typical access, no unusual obstacles.

Common Size and System Type Scenarios With Price Ranges

The door height, wire gauge, and system type (single vs. dual spring) clearly shift the price. A standard 7–8 ft single-spring install averages $300–$600, while a dual-spring system typically runs $500–$900 installed. Extra-long doors, high-torque designs, or non-standard colors can push costs higher. Assumptions: standard garage door, no structural work required, regional labor variance considered.

Ways to Cut Costs Without Compromising Safety

Bundle a replacement with a routine door balance check to avoid repeat labor charges. If the door already requires maintenance, addressing alignment, track lubrication, and safety eye calibration in one visit can reduce overall costs. Consider opting for standard springs rather than premium finishes if aesthetics permit, and only replace damaged components that affect operation. Assumptions: no structural frame damage; standard tools available.

Variables That Strongly Impact the Final Quote

Two numeric drivers commonly shift pricing: door height (7–8 ft vs. 8–10 ft) and spring wire diameter (small vs. heavy). Expect price to rise by 15–30% if the door is 9 ft or taller. Another driver is the number of springs: a dual-spring system adds roughly $150–$300 in parts and 1–2 hours of labor. Assumptions: typical suburban project, standard safety checks included.

How to Compare Quotes Effectively

When evaluating bids, prioritize the components list and warranty terms. Ask for a fixed-price quote that covers materials, labor, and disposal. Ensure quoted safety devices are clearly listed, and verify whether weather conditions or revised permits could affect the timeline. Assumptions: comparable door sizes and system types across quotes.
